Overview
- Explains the application of Phasor Measurement Units to control and analyze power systems
- Presents numerous case studies, including wind power systems, to which PMUs can be applied
- Offers constructive methods to deal with concerns that surround the tool

For the operation of transmission and distribution systems, the book explains the dynamics of power systems and explores how well-established tools such as energy-based control and Kalman filters can address many of the existing and developing issues in their operation. By providing a thorough guide to PMUs, this book enables readers to fully understand the potential benefits their implementation can bring.
